What are ESG frameworks?

ESG has become a mainstream concern for all businesses. There are no uniform standards to guide ESG reporting. While hundreds of ESG frameworks exist, specific standards have emerged as the preferred guidelines for ESG implementation and reporting. Examples include the Sustainable Financial Disclosure Regulations (SFDR) in the EU and the Sustainable Disclosure Regulations (SDR) in the UK. These ESG frameworks guide the metrics you should focus on, reporting and plans for future ESG strategies.

ESG stands for Environmental, Social and Governance. It refers to the set of standards businesses follow to operate responsibly, reduce environmental impact, ensure social responsibility and maintain transparent governance practices.

Implementing ESG practices helps businesses reduce risks, improve operational efficiency, attract investors and build trust with customers and stakeholders. ESG compliance is increasingly linked to financial performance and long-term sustainability.

Facilities management contributes to ESG by improving energy efficiency, reducing waste, maintaining sustainable building systems and ensuring compliance with environmental and social regulations. Monitoring and reporting tools help track progress and demonstrate accountability.

Environmental considerations include energy efficiency, carbon footprint reduction, water management, waste management and the adoption of renewable energy sources. Facilities maintenance and operational strategies can have a direct impact on these areas.

Social aspects focus on employee wellbeing, health and safety, community engagement, diversity and inclusion and ethical labour practices. Facilities and operations teams can enhance social responsibility by ensuring safe, accessible and comfortable work environments.

Governance involves transparent leadership, regulatory compliance, ethical decision-making, data protection, risk management and stakeholder engagement. Proper documentation and reporting are essential for meeting governance standards.

Companies can report ESG performance through frameworks like TCFD, SECR, CSRD and SDR. Facilities data, energy usage reports and compliance records support these disclosures, helping businesses meet investor and regulatory expectations.
